rpms/usb_modeswitch/F-11 sources,1.4,1.5 usb_modeswitch.spec,1.4,1.5
Bernie Innocenti
bernie at fedoraproject.org
Mon May 10 03:24:44 UTC 2010
Author: bernie
Update of /cvs/pkgs/rpms/usb_modeswitch/F-11
In directory cvs01.phx2.fedoraproject.org:/tmp/cvs-serv5596
Modified Files:
sources usb_modeswitch.spec
Log Message:
Backport 1.1.2-3 from devel branch
Index: sources
===================================================================
RCS file: /cvs/pkgs/rpms/usb_modeswitch/F-11/sources,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-p -r1.4 -r1.5
--- sources 17 Sep 2009 09:11:11 -0000 1.4
+++ sources 10 May 2010 03:24:44 -0000 1.5
@@ -1 +1 @@
-294848bbbcbd77dc9a4caf08327ca297 usb_modeswitch-1.0.5.tar.bz2
+071cb300d00938bfe20025c654303d92 usb-modeswitch-1.1.2.tar.bz2
Index: usb_modeswitch.spec
===================================================================
RCS file: /cvs/pkgs/rpms/usb_modeswitch/F-11/usb_modeswitch.spec,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-p -r1.4 -r1.5
--- usb_modeswitch.spec 17 Sep 2009 09:11:11 -0000 1.4
+++ usb_modeswitch.spec 10 May 2010 03:24:44 -0000 1.5
@@ -1,13 +1,16 @@
+%define source_name usb-modeswitch
+
Name: usb_modeswitch
-Version: 1.0.5
-Release: 1%{?dist}
+Version: 1.1.2
+Release: 3%{?dist}
Summary: USB Modeswitch gets 4G cards in operational mode
Summary(de): USB Modeswitch aktiviert UMTS-Karten
Group: Applications/System
License: GPLv2+
URL: http://www.draisberghof.de/usb_modeswitch/
-Source0: http://www.draisberghof.de/%{name}/%{name}-%{version}.tar.bz2
+Source0: http://www.draisberghof.de/%{name}/%{source_name}-%{version}.tar.bz2
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
+Requires: usb_modeswitch-data
BuildRequires: libusb-devel
%description
@@ -23,29 +26,70 @@ Dadurch erkennt Linux die Datenkarte und
Verbindungen aufbauen. Die gängigen Karten von Huawei, T-Mobile,
Vodafone, Option, ZTE und Novatell werden unterstützt.
+
%prep
-%setup -q
+%setup -q -n %{source_name}-%{version}
%build
-gcc $RPM_OPT_FLAGS -l usb -o usb_modeswitch usb_modeswitch.c
+CFLAGS="$RPM_OPT_FLAGS" make %{?_smp_mflags}
+
%install
rm -rf $RPM_BUILD_ROOT
-mkdir -p $RPM_BUILD_ROOT%{_bindir}
-mkdir $RPM_BUILD_ROOT%{_sysconfdir}
-install -p -m 755 usb_modeswitch $RPM_BUILD_ROOT%{_bindir}/
+mkdir -p $RPM_BUILD_ROOT/lib/udev/rules.d/
+mkdir -p $RPM_BUILD_ROOT%{_sbindir}
+mkdir -p $RPM_BUILD_ROOT%{_mandir}/man1
+mkdir -p $RPM_BUILD_ROOT%{_sysconfdir}
+
+install -p -m 755 usb_modeswitch $RPM_BUILD_ROOT%{_sbindir}/
install -p -m 644 usb_modeswitch.conf $RPM_BUILD_ROOT%{_sysconfdir}/
+install -p -m 644 usb_modeswitch.setup $RPM_BUILD_ROOT%{_sysconfdir}/
+gzip -9c usb_modeswitch.1 > usb_modeswitch.1.gz && install -m 644 usb_modeswitch.1.gz $RPM_BUILD_ROOT%{_datadir}/man/man1
+install -p -m 755 usb_modeswitch.tcl $RPM_BUILD_ROOT/lib/udev/usb_modeswitch
%clean
rm -rf $RPM_BUILD_ROOT
%files
%defattr(-,root,root,-)
-%{_bindir}/usb_modeswitch
+%{_sbindir}/usb_modeswitch
+%{_mandir}/man1/usb_modeswitch.1.gz
+/lib/udev/usb_modeswitch
%config(noreplace) %{_sysconfdir}/usb_modeswitch.conf
-%doc COPYING README*
+%config(noreplace) %{_sysconfdir}/usb_modeswitch.setup
+%doc COPYING README ChangeLog
+
%changelog
+* Fri Apr 23 2010 Huzaifa Sidhpurwala <huzaifas at redhat.com> - 1.1.2-3
+- Fix typo in binary location
+
+* Fri Apr 23 2010 Huzaifa Sidhpurwala <huzaifas at redhat.com> - 1.1.2-2
+- Move usb_modeswitch binary back to /usr/sbin
+- Package /etc/usb_modeswitch.setup for manual mode
+
+* Tue Apr 20 2010 Huzaifa Sidhpurwala <huzaifas at redhat.com> - 1.1.2-1
+- New upstream
+- Split data and main package
+
+* Mon Mar 8 2010 Huzaifa Sidhpurwala <huzaifas at redhat.com> - 1.1.0-6
+- Version bump for F-12 build
+
+* Sat Mar 6 2010 Huzaifa Sidhpurwala <huzaifas at redaht.com> - 1.1.0-5
+- Fix regression in rhbz #571001
+- Version bump
+
+* Thu Mar 4 2010 Huzaifa Sidhpurwala <huzaifas at redhat.com> 1.1.0-3
+- Patch usb_modeswtich to use the binary from /usr/bin/
+- usb_modeswitch-data needs tcl
+
+* Wed Mar 2 2010 Huzaifa Sidhpurwala <huzaifas at redhat.com> 1.1.0-2
+- Reload udev when new rules are installed
+
+* Wed Mar 2 2010 Huzaifa Sidhpurwala <huzaifas at redhat.com> 1.1.0-1
+- New upstream 1.1.0 release
+- Split package into binary and data part
+
* Thu Sep 17 2009 Peter Robinson <pbrobinson at gmail.com> 1.0.5-1
- new upstream 1.0.5 release
More information about the scm-commits
mailing list